Medical Tourism Market Dynamics: Key Drivers, Restraints, Opportunities, and Challenges
The global medical tourism market is witnessing strong expansion as international patients increasingly travel across borders to access cost-effective, high-quality healthcare services. Rising healthcare costs in developed economies, long waiting times for elective procedures, and improved access to advanced treatments in emerging countries are reshaping the competitive landscape. In this evolving scenario, Medical Tourism Market Dynamics play a crucial role in determining how providers, facilitators, and governments collaborate to strengthen healthcare infrastructure and patient experience. Growing awareness about specialized treatments, supportive government policies, and improved global connectivity continue to influence market momentum.
A major dynamic shaping the market is the cost advantage offered by emerging destinations compared to developed regions. Patients from North America and Europe are increasingly seeking affordable alternatives for procedures such as cardiac surgeries, cosmetic treatments, orthopedic surgeries, and fertility treatments. In many cases, treatment costs in medical tourism destinations can be significantly lower while maintaining comparable quality standards.

Additionally, the presence of internationally accredited hospitals and skilled medical professionals has boosted trust and confidence among international patients, further strengthening cross-border healthcare demand.
Technological advancements also play a pivotal role in market development. Telemedicine, digital patient records, and virtual consultations have simplified pre- and post-treatment communication between patients and healthcare providers. This integration of technology has made it easier for patients to plan travel, consult specialists, and receive follow-up care after returning home. Furthermore, healthcare providers are adopting digital marketing strategies and patient engagement platforms to enhance visibility and streamline patient journeys, contributing to stronger global demand.
Government initiatives and policy support are another key aspect of the market’s dynamic environment. Several countries are actively promoting medical tourism by simplifying visa processes, offering medical visas, and investing in world-class healthcare infrastructure. Partnerships between tourism boards, hospitals, and travel facilitators are helping create comprehensive medical travel packages that include treatment, accommodation, and tourism experiences. Such coordinated efforts are improving accessibility and attracting a growing number of international patients.
The increasing demand for specialized and elective procedures is further influencing market growth. Treatments related to cosmetic surgery, dental care, fertility, and wellness therapies are gaining popularity due to their affordability and shorter waiting periods abroad. Additionally, the rising prevalence of chronic diseases worldwide is pushing patients to seek advanced treatment options beyond their home countries, thereby strengthening the demand for global healthcare mobility.
Despite its promising growth trajectory, the market faces certain challenges. Concerns related to travel risks, post-treatment complications, and lack of standardized regulations across countries can affect patient decisions. However, industry stakeholders are actively working to address these challenges through international accreditation standards, improved patient safety protocols, and enhanced medical liability frameworks. These initiatives are expected to build greater trust and transparency in the long term.
Overall, the medical tourism market is shaped by a complex interplay of cost advantages, technological advancements, policy support, and evolving patient preferences. As healthcare systems continue to globalize and patients prioritize affordability and quality, the market is poised to experience sustained growth in the coming years.
